摘要: 通过对典型环形机械零件同步器齿环和齿轮的分析,发现环形零件具有不规则自相似性,因此采用分形理论及分形维数算法(结构函数法和盒子法)计算同步器齿环和齿轮的分形维数,证明了用分形理论可以表示环形零件的测量特征。进一步研究基于分形测量特征的环形零件缺陷识别问题,结果表明:盒子法相比较于结构函数法识别缺陷同步器齿环具有更好的稳定性和准确性;结构函数法相比较盒子法识别缺陷齿轮具有更好的稳定性和准确性;不同的环形零件利用不同的分形维数算法,可以计算出其不同的测量特征。

Abstract: The analysis of typical mechanical parts synchronizer ring and gear shows that annular parts have an irregular self-similarity.Therefore,the use of fractal theory and fractal dimension algorithm (structure function method and the box method)to calculate the fractal dimension of synchronizer ring and gear,proved that measured characteristics of annular part can be expressed by fractal theory.Further research papers based on fractal characteristics of measuring parts of the annular defect identification problem.The results showed that:compared to structure function method to identify defects synchronizer ring,box method has better stability and accuracy;structure function method has better stability and accuracy to identify defects gear;using different parts of the ring different fractal dimension algorithm can calculate the different measurement characteristics.
